Backup

This page allows Administrator to backup the recorded data to an USB storage. Please remember to format the USB disk as EXT3 USB Storage file format for the first time use.

After you insert the USB device, it will be displayed on the Hard disk information column as below. You can format the USB here. Please remember to click Eject before unloading the USB device.

Scheduled Backup

This column is for you to select what kind of recording data you want to backup. Check or uncheck the Enabled blanks, and then select a Backup Time. Finally click Apply to start backup.

Manually Backup

This column is for you to backup all recorded data during a specific range of time. Select a desired option and time, and then click Backup to start the backup procedure.
